denshooter
52586ef28a
Merge branch 'dev' into production
CI / CD / test-build (push) Successful in 10m14s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 23s
2026-04-22 11:50:28 +02:00
denshooter
a44a90c69d
Merge branch 'dev' into production
CI / CD / deploy-dev (push) Has been cancelled
CI / CD / deploy-production (push) Has been cancelled
CI / CD / test-build (push) Has been cancelled
2026-04-22 11:43:52 +02:00
denshooter
258143b362
Merge branch 'dev' into production
CI / CD / test-build (push) Successful in 10m14s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 23s
2026-04-19 15:47:39 +02:00
denshooter
edd8dc58ab
Merge branch 'dev' into production
CI / CD / test-build (push) Successful in 10m15s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 23s
2026-04-17 09:50:38 +02:00
denshooter
f17f0031a1
Merge branch 'dev' into production
2026-04-16 14:39:54 +02:00
denshooter
4d5dc1f8f9
Merge branch 'dev' into production
CI / CD / test-build (push) Successful in 10m15s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 24s
2026-04-15 15:53:22 +02:00
denshooter
8397e5acf2
Merge dev into production
CI / CD / test-build (push) Successful in 10m19s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 23s
2026-04-09 18:02:37 +02:00
denshooter
5bcaade558
Merge dev into production
CI / CD / test-build (push) Successful in 10m14s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 23s
2026-04-09 17:23:29 +02:00
denshooter
aee811309b
fix: scroll to top on locale switch and remove dashes from hero text
...
CI / CD / test-build (push) Successful in 10m15s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 1m53s
- HeaderClient: track locale prop changes with useRef and call
window.scrollTo on switch to reliably reset scroll position
- messages/en.json + de.json: replace em dash with comma and remove
hyphens from Self-Hoster/Full-Stack in hero description
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com >
2026-03-08 14:37:56 +01:00
denshooter
48a29cd872
fix: pass locale explicitly to Hero and force-dynamic on locale-sensitive API routes
...
CI / CD / test-build (push) Successful in 10m11s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 1m28s
- Hero.tsx: pass locale prop directly to getTranslations instead of
relying on setRequestLocale async storage, which can be lost during
Next.js RSC streaming
- book-reviews route: replace revalidate=300 with force-dynamic to
prevent cached English responses being served to German locale requests
- content/page route: add runtime=nodejs and force-dynamic (was missing
both, violating CLAUDE.md API route conventions)
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com >
2026-03-08 13:43:26 +01:00
denshooter
c95fc3101b
chore: merge branch 'dev' into 'production' (Release: Design Overhaul & Admin Redesign)
CI / CD / test-build (push) Successful in 10m9s
CI / CD / deploy-dev (push) Has been skipped
CI / CD / deploy-production (push) Successful in 24s
2026-03-08 13:18:26 +01:00